A behandelprotocol, or treatment protocol, is a structured plan outlining the steps and procedures to be followed in the treatment of a specific condition or patient. It serves as a guideline for healthcare professionals to ensure consistent, effective, and safe care. The development of a behandelprotocol typically involves a multidisciplinary team, including physicians, nurses, therapists, and other specialists, who collaborate to determine the most appropriate interventions based on the latest medical evidence and best practices.
